3.5.11 E5-00 – Outdoor unit: Overheat of inverter compressor motor
Trigger
Effect
Reset
Compressor overload is
detected.
Unit will NOT stop
operating.
Automatic reset if the unit
runs without warning for
60 seconds.
To solve the error code
INFORMATION
It is recommended to perform the checks in the listed order.
1
Check that all stop valves of the refrigerant circuit are open. See
62].
Possible cause:
Closed stop valve in the refrigerant circuit.
2
Perform a check of the discharge pipe thermistor. See Thermistors.
Possible cause:
Faulty discharge pipe thermistor or connector fault.
3
Perform a check of the outdoor unit fan motor. See Outdoor unit fan motor.
Possible cause:
Faulty outdoor unit fan motor.
4
Perform a check of the compressor. See Compressor.
Possible cause:
Faulty compressor or miswiring of the compressor power
supply cable.
5
Perform a check of the expansion valve. See Expansion valve.
Possible cause:
Faulty expansion valve.
6
Perform a check of the 4‑way valve. See 4-way valve.
Possible cause:
Faulty 4‑way valve.
7
Perform a check of the main PCB. See Main PCB.
Possible cause:
Faulty main PCB.
8
Check if the refrigerant circuit is correctly charged. See
62].
Possible cause:
Refrigerant shortage.
9
Check for the presence of non‑condensables and/or humidity in the
refrigerant circuit. See
Possible cause:
Non‑condensables and/or humidity in the refrigerant circuit.
10
Check if the refrigerant circuit is clogged. See
62].
Possible cause:
Clogged refrigerant circuit.
